THE HALF-MILE HAT Lodge, Bernard 1995 13310 From Publishers Weekly Lodge's (There Was an Old Woman Who Lived in a Glove) fanciful story centers on a giant with an expansive straw hat. When the North Wind and the South Wind happen to arrive at the same time, they send a shepherd's hat flying through the air. Searching for it, Yorrick the shepherd encounters a sleeping giant, and gets lost as he sneaks onto the giant's boot. He wanders upon a walled city, wherein, calling upon the giant and his humongous headgear-and overcoming a few extra obstacles-he earns the hand of the king's daughter. Vivid hues and a mildly folkloric feel make Lodge's illustrations as diverting to look at as his tall (or wide) tale is to read. Ages 5-9. Copyright 1995 Reed Business Information, Inc.
